How Does Murrieta Gardens Compare to Other Murrieta Facilities?

Murrieta Gardens offers unique features compared to other local facilities, including pet-friendly policies and dietary accommodations like low-sodium meal plans. Cost-competitiveness is reflected in memory care pricing, which ranges from $4,320 to $6,675 monthly, as detailed by Seniorly. Testimonials from families often highlight the transformative effect of the facility’s compassionate care on their loved ones’ lives. Mobility and Safety Enhancements at Murrieta Gardens

A commitment to resident safety and independence is evident through advanced mobility solutions, such as the introduction of VELA chairs. These chairs feature height-adjustable seats and braked wheels, substantially aiding the mobility and self-sufficiency of residents with limited mobility. By allowing safe participation in daily activities, these chairs empower residents with cognitive or physical impairments, ensuring both safety and engagement. How much does Murrieta Gardens Senior Living & Memory Care cost per month?

Murrieta Gardens offers cost-friendly memory care, with monthly pricing ranging from $4,320 to $6,675, according to Seniorly. This competitive pricing reflects the facility’s commitment to providing high-quality and compassionate care in an accessible way.
